No. 23 Softball Drops Two on Opening Day

BABSON PARK, Fla. (February 16, 2023) - The new-look Webber International University softball team matched up against the Truett McConnell University Bears in a doubleheader on Thursday afternoon to open the 2023 season. Unfortunately, the Warriors were defeated 5-0 in game one and 2-1 in game two.

Junior Jenna Chaudoin was the starting pitcher for the Warriors (0-2 overall) in game one as she allowed five runs on eight hits in 4.1 innings pitched. It mattered little, however, as Webber was held to just three hits in total thanks to the Bears' (2-2) ace.

Truett McConnell scored the first run of the game in the second inning on an RBI-single before busting the game open with four more runs in the top of the fifth. The Warriors three hits came via Brandy Barquin, Genesis Aviles, and Johnkira Bland, all of which were singles. Chloe Rayner and Anastasia Suhetskis both earned their collegiate debuts in the pitchers' circle as Rayner allowed no runs and no hits in 1.2 innings while Suhetskis tallied two strikeouts in one inning.

There was yet another collegiate debut for freshman pitcher in Victoria Nearing as she got the nod on the rubber and threw all seven innings, allowing two runs on just one hit and tallying two strikeouts.

The Bears scored early on a sacrifice fly in the first inning and doubled their lead the very next inning after a runner scored on a pass ball. Webber responded the next half-inning courtesy of a triple down the right-field line by Gracie Lopez, scoring Kimmie Cheung. The remainder of the game was scoreless as both pitchers settled into a groove.

Lopez finished 1-of-3 with a triple and an RBI followed by Nearing who finished 1-of-3 and Bland who was 1-of-2. Nicole Gutierrez came in as a pinch hitter and delivered a double down the left-field line.

The schedule only gets tougher for the Warriors as they face two top-25 opponents next week. First they match up against No. 2 University of Mobile in a doubleheader on Wednesday, February 22nd at 1 and 3 p.m. before facing No. 11 Grand View University twice on Saturday, February 26th.
